AI Contract Overview
The contract involves the transportation and final-mile delivery of one gallon of Aromatic Naphtha to a U.S. military facility in South Korea, requiring full compliance with international hazardous materials regulations. This includes specialized packaging certified for hazardous substances, export documentation, and coordination through both U.S. and South Korean customs authorities to ensure timely and legal clearance. The shipment must adhere to all applicable safety, handling, and regulatory standards for transporting flammable liquids across international borders. As a subcontract under the Defense Logistics Agency of the Department of Defense, the work is classified under NAICS code 488999 for other support activities for transportation. The contract is tied to a specific military logistics operation and requires strict adherence to U.S. government export control protocols, including potential ITAR or EAR compliance, despite the minimal volume involved. All logistics operations must align with the DLA’s procedural and security requirements, reflecting the sensitive nature of deliveries to U.S. defense installations overseas.
